Released on: Autogram (German label) Reference number: ALLP 201 Year of release: 1976 Produced and directed by: Dave Travis Engineer: Paul Holland Musicians: Gerry Lockran - vocal and guitar Ted Hatton - lead guitar Jed Livesey - piano Jeff Whittington - bass guitar Lloyd Ryan - drums 'Pocahontas' - harmonica |
|||
SIDE ONE 1. Hoochie-Coochie Man (Dixon) 2. Nobody Knows You When You're Down And Out (Cox) 3. Woman Lover (McGhee) 4. Bottom Blues (Brunner) 5. Sittin' Pretty (McGhee and Walter) 6. St James' Infirmary Blues (Primrose) 7. Evil-Hearted Man (Traditional, arranged by Lockran) 8. Cornbread (Lockran) |
SIDE TWO 1. New John Henry's Blues (Lockran/Travis) 2. Careless Love Blues (Handy) 3. Ain't No More Cane On The Brazos (Lockran) 4. Southern Roll (Lockran) 5. Take This Hammer (Lockran/Travis) 6. That's All Right Mama (Crudup) 7. Goin' Down To Memphis (Travis) 8. I Know More About This Old Heart (Travis) |
